Contour plots showing bits of information in an intensity measurement as a function of Z O and for ( a ) acentric and ( b ) centric intensity measurements. Contour lines are drawn, from the blue region through orange to yellow, at 0.01, 0.03, 0.1, 0.3, 1, 3 and 10 bits of information. This figure and Figs. 2–5 were prepared using Mathematica (Wolfram Research, Champaign, Illinois, USA).

Journal: Acta Crystallographica. Section D, Structural Biology

Article Title: Measuring and using information gained by observing diffraction data

doi: 10.1107/S2059798320001588

Figure Lengend Snippet: Contour plots showing bits of information in an intensity measurement as a function of Z O and for ( a ) acentric and ( b ) centric intensity measurements. Contour lines are drawn, from the blue region through orange to yellow, at 0.01, 0.03, 0.1, 0.3, 1, 3 and 10 bits of information. This figure and Figs. 2–5 were prepared using Mathematica (Wolfram Research, Champaign, Illinois, USA).

Article Snippet: A table of normalized standard deviations corresponding to different thresholds of expected information gain was evaluated by numerical integration in the symbolic mathematics program Mathematica (Wolfram Research, Champaign, Illinois, USA) and was then used to define thresholds in Phaser (McCoy et al. , 2007 ) without new functions having to be implemented.
